FIRST - PROPERTY CONDITIONS
The property that is the object of the lease is the property described in the advertisement published through the LESSOR's services, and all the characteristics of the property are unequivocally known to the LESSEE, who declares to receive in excellent conditions of hygiene, cleanliness and functioning of the hydraulic, sanitary and electrical and all accessories incorporated into the property, such as: flooring, windows, doors, latches, handles, locks, window panes, etc. lease without the right to indemnification or retention of the property for any improvement, even if necessary.
The keys to the property will be delivered in the manner indicated by the LESSOR.
The LESSEE is not allowed to make changes or renovations to the premises of the contracted property.
SECOND - PURPOSE OF THE LEASE
The leased property is exclusively intended for TEMPORARY RESIDENTIAL use, and the LESSOR is prohibited from assigning or lending it in whole or in part, in any capacity. Any tolerance of the LESSOR will not imply tacit consent.
FAMILY parties and gatherings are permitted, with the maximum audience not exceeding 1.5 times the maximum capacity of the property. (Example: if the maximum capacity is 10 people, the maximum audience for the party/family gathering will be 15 people)
Commercial parties with loud, live music or large numbers of guests are STRICTLY forbidden. Smoking is also FORBIDDEN inside the property and in the communal areas of the condominium.
Also, it is not allowed to make any installations, adaptations, improvements or works without the express authorization of the LESSOR. These, once allowed and executed, will immediately adhere to the property, and the LESSEE will not be entitled to any indemnity;
